Region Setting default after re-activation – S3 buckets used shift
-
After de-activating the polly plugin the settings previously saved are not all restored.
—
1.setup the plugin with S3 creds & FRA for region; a FRA s3 bucket ‘A’ is made.
2.generate some contents
3.deactivate the plugin
4.activate the plugin
-behavior-
-the plugin has the previous s3 creds
-the plugin is defaulting to the US-East-1 region
-a new s3 bucket ‘B’ is created in US-EAST-1-expected behavior-
-the plugin has the previous s3 creds
-the plugin remained to use the FRA region as set
-the plugin would continue to use the previously created S3 bucket ‘A’Issue1: The plugin creates a -new- FRA s3 bucket ‘C’ at correction; making all previously generated content unreachable.
Issue2: The pluging does not restore the original region setting at re-activatewp: 4.9.8
php: 7.0.30
WpPolly : 2.5.5
